Abstract

An upstanding flange is provided for support from a shower enclosure having an open side and the flange generally parallels the medial plane of the open side of the enclosure and projects into the opening defined thereby. A lower portion of the flange includes a slot formed therein opening through the marginal edge portion projecting into the enclosure opening and the inner end of the slot is disposed at a higher elevation than the open end thereof and the slot is of a width to snugly receive the corresponding edge portion of a curtain drawn across the opening of the shower enclosure.

I l I I 1 k I 1J 1 5 /0 l \i 1I 1% 1 3g f u l\ /4 l 1 I /Z l 26 24 TUB SHOWER SPRAY DIVERTER BACKGROUND OF THE INVENTION Shower enclosures, and particularly those incorporating a tub and utilizing a shower curtain drawn across the open side of the shower enclosure are subject to water flowing or splashing out of the enclosure around the ends of the associated shower curtain, even though the shower curtain has its lower marginal portion wholly within the tub portion. Various structures have heretofore been designed for the purpose of providing a more efficient barrier to water flowing or being splashed from a shower enclosure. Some of these structures are disclosed in US. Pat. Nos. 2,049,061, to J. A. Hoegger, Sr.. dated July 28, 1938, No. 2,761,150, to N. H. Kellogg. dated Sept. 4, 1956, No. 2,748,908, to G. L Jacobson, et al.. dated June 5, 1956, and No. 3,205,547, to N. B. Riekse. dated Sept. 14, 1965.
While some of these devices have been at least somewhat efficient in preventing water flowing or spraying from shower enclosures, these previous devices require special shower curtains or panels and/or special shower curtain vertical edge portions as well as specifically constructed wall mounted brackets. These previously patented devices have not met with commercial success. partly due to their initial cost and/or their complex manner of use.
BRIEF DESCRIPTION OF THE INVENTION The shower spray diverter of the instant invention is utilized in conjunction with a conventional shower curtain and comprises a one piece flange semipermanently mounted at one side edge portion of the open side of a shower enclosure. The flange or flange member is supported from the corresponding wall of the enclosure in a manner such that the flange projects into the open side of the enclosure and has its lower end abutted against and sealed relative to the corresponding end of the upper marginal edge portion of the outer side of the associated tub component. The lower end of the flange is provided with a slot opening through the free vertical edge portion thereof and the inner end of the slot is disposed at a higher elevation than the lower end thereof opening through the free edge of the flange. The slot is of a width to snugly receive the corresponding marginal portion of the associated shower curtain therein. In this manner. the flange itself functions to prevent substantially all water spray within the associated end of the shower enclosure from passing around the associated end of the shower curtain. which end of the shower curtain is disposed on the outside of the flange. In addition. should any spray from within the shower enclosure find its way to the inner surface of the shower curtain disposed outwardly of the flange above the slot therein in which the shower curtain is frictionally retained, when this spray has collected sufficiently on the inner surface of the shower curtain to run down along the latter as soon as the water rolling down the inner surface of the curtain reaches that portion of the curtain passing through the slot. it is deflected inwardly by the portion of the curtain passed through the slot and back into the shower enclosure below the upper marginal portion of the corresponding side of the tub component of the shower enclosure.

numeral generally designates a conventional tub and shower enclosure includingopposite end walls 12 and 14 interconnected along their rear marginal edge portions by means of arear wall 16. A conventionalshower curtain rod 18 extends between and is supported from theend walls 12 and 14 and supports a conventional flexible and waterimpervious shower curtain 20 by means of a plurality of spacedrings 22 slidable along therod 18.
The lower portion of theenclosure 10 includes atub component 24 extending lengthwise between thewalls 12 and 14 and including anouter side 26.
Conventionally, thecurtain 20 is drawn to the right as viewed in FIG. 1 of the drawings in order to at least somewhat effectively prevent spray from the shower from falling outside thetub component 24. However, the use of a hot water spray in a shower stall can cause sufficient air currents to blow either end of theshower curtain 20 out of position and once either end of the shower curtain has been blown out of position, its misposition may not be noticed by the user of theenclosure 10 with the result that considerable quantities of water flow outwardly of or spray from theenclosure 10 onto thefloor 28 outside thetub component 24, even though the lower marginal portion of thecurtain 22 may still be disposed within thetub component 24.
The first form of spray diverter illustrated in FIGS. 1-5 of the drawings is generally referred to in general by thereference numeral 30 and includes anupstanding flange 32 having an upstandingfree edge portion 34 and an opposite upstandingbase edge portion 36. Theflange 32 is positioned with itsbase edge portion 36 closely opposing theend wall 14 and itsfree edge portion 34 projecting into the opening of theshower enclosure 10 defined above the uppermarginal edge portion 38 of theouter side 26 of thetub component 24. The lower end of theflange 32 is abutted against the uppermarginal edge portion 38 at the end thereof abutted against theend wall 14 of theenclosure 10 and thebase edge portion 36 of theflange 32 includes a rightangle base flange 40 which overlies theend wall 14, is adhered thereto in any convenient manner such as by adhesive 42 and projects toward theback wall 16 of theenclosure 10. Theflanges 32 and 40 each extend the full length of thediverter 30 and the lower ends of theflanges 32 and 40 are interconnected by means of a generally triangularhorizontal web 44 formed integrally with theflanges 32 and 40 and extending therebetween. In addition. the upper end portions of theflanges 32 and 40 are interconnected by means of a generally rectangularhorizontal web 46 formed integrally with and extending between theflanges 32 and 40 and a third generallyhorizontal web 48 of generally rectangular plane shape is formed integrally with and extends between theflanges 32 and 40 a spaced distance below theweb 46. The central area of theweb 48 is depressed as at 50 and provided with acentral drain aperture 52. Of course. theweb 48 is provided to form a convenient soap dish and is at least partially protected from spray from above by theweb 46 disposed thereabove. Also, the free edge portion of theflange 32 is provided with avertical slot 54 spaced slightly inwardly of thefree edge 34 and centrally intermediate 4 the upper an dgloweren ds oftheflange 32 and defines a convenient hand grip.
The lowerend'po'rtion of theflange 32 is provided withaslot 56, audit ,will be seen that theslot 56 is inclined with its inner, end disposed'uppermost and its lower end openingthr oughthe free edge 30 a distance spaced slightly above the lower end of theflange 32. Theslot 56 is of a width adaptecl to snugly receive the corresponding edge .portion SS of thecurtain 20 therein in the manner illustrated in FIG. 2 of the drawings, and it will be appreciated that the snugness of theslot 56 is sufficient to frictionally retain theedge portion 58 of curtain 2( within thisslot 56 against accidental dislodgment from theslot 56.
If it is desired, a spray diverter referred to in general by thereference numeral 60 and comprising a substantial mirror duplicate of thediverter 30 may be used at the opposite endof thetub component 24 and adhered to theend wall 12 of theenclosure 10. Thus, both vertical edge portions of thecurtain 20 may be engaged in the slots provided in thediverters 30 and 60 when the tub shower enclosure is in use.
In operation, inasmuch as the ends .of thecurtain 20 will be disposed outside thespray diverters 30 and 60 above the inclined slots formed therein, the spray diverters themselves will prevent substantially all spray from passing outwardly of theenclosure 10 around the ends of thecurtain 20. However, should any strong sprays of water pass behind thediverters 60 and cause water to collect on the inner surfaces of the ends of the curtain disposed outwardly of thediverters 30 and 60 above the inclined slots therein. this collected water will eventually roll down the inner surfaces of the ends of thecurtain 20 and be diverted inwardly by those portions of the ends of the curtain passing through theinclined slots 56.
From FIG. 1 of the drawings it will be seen that the inclined slots are slightly arcuate in configuration and arranged so=as to be upwardly convex.
